They import ores because ABC is desired and "common" rocks only hit when they run out and to boost the index (which gets more ABC to mine even more....see the cycle here?). Put another way...they outsource the stuff they don't want to do.


Its not lack of tanked (or being affected by warp disruption) that kills null sec mining. I was in quite a few homes you could mine in relative peace and quiet. A good home will have the intel (or volunteers to scout you) to make safer gate jumps. Or the intel to see the hac roam coming several systems out to know it was time to pack up, gtfo and safe pos it up.

If your home is lacking these features that is a personnel issue in the corp/alliance, not the mining ships. Tanked BS ratters also die when people cba to post intel or take 2 minutes to scout out a corp mate.
